At WISER, we are creating a lightweight, AI-enabled learning platform that brings together YouTube videos, interactive quizzes, and automated certificates, all connected through APIs and no-code tools. The goal is to launch a simple but functional MVP that lets learners:

  1. Watch educational YouTube videos

  2. Ask AI questions about the content

  3. Complete quizzes

  4. Receive a completion certificate
     

You will use existing tools (e.g., Bubble, Make, Retool, or Webflow) and APIs (YouTube, OpenAI, Google Sheets, or Firebase) to rapidly prototype and connect the components into a seamless experience.


What You’ll Do:

  • Set up a web-based learning dashboard using a no-code or low-code platform (Bubble, Webflow, or Glide).

  • Integrate YouTube videos and their captions via the YouTube API.

  • Connect an AI chat or Q&A interface using the OpenAI API to query video transcripts.

  • Build a quiz interface (Google Forms, Moodle. Typeform, or Bubble component) with scoring and completion logic.

  • Automate certificate generation (PDF) upon quiz completion using tools like Github scripts.

  • Store and manage user data using Google Sheets, Airtable, or Firebase.

  • Design lightweight dashboards for learner progress and admin control.

  • Ensure all integrations are secure and scalable enough for pilot testing.​​​​
